What I Look for in the Shade
For me, the most important thing is undertone. Maybelline Fit Me 250 usually suits warm or neutral-warm skin tones, so I always compare it with my jawline and neck before buying. I also pay attention to how it changes in natural light because that helps me avoid a shade that looks too orange or too dull.

How I Test the Match Before Buying
I never rely only on the bottle or online image. I test the shade on my jawline and check it in daylight. If I am shopping online, I compare swatches, reviews, and shade descriptions carefully. This helps me feel more confident that Maybelline Fit Me 250 will blend naturally with my skin.
